Fault Message:
GEN3 DELTA CURRENT FAULT
Fault Code:
2423118LPS
Associated CAS:
| Reporting LRU: | Generator Control Unit (GCU) 3 |
| System Description: | 24-21-00 |
| Schematic Diagram: | 24-21-00 [ Global Express ] [ G5000 ] [ Global XRS ] |
| Wiring Diagram: | 24-21-03 [ Global Express ] [ G5000 ] [ Global XRS ] |
Fault Description:
The Generator Control Unit (GCU) 3 detects between two phases a difference in output current larger than 35 A ±5 A.
Possible Causes:
- AC Power Center (ACPC) (A54)
- Generator Control Unit (GCU) 3 (A58)
- Variable Frequency Generator (VFG) 3 (G3)
- Associated Wiring
Troubleshooting Tips:
Advisory Wire/Service Bulletin: None
Forum Articles/Infoservice/Newsletter: None
A GCU patch cable (GSE REF # 24X-24-02) can be used to swap GCUs 1, 4 and 5 into position 2 or 3 (for troubleshooting only).
The GCU NVMs can only be downloaded at position #2 or #3.

Troubleshooting Recommendations:
- Check for CAIMS message related to the ACPC short circuit fault. Clear/troubleshoot the message first if existed.
- If system checks are good, do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Swap GCU 3 with GCU 2 (physically or using the GCU patch cable).
NOTE: Use PMAT to monitor the fault on GCU.- If system checks are good, replace GCU 3 and do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Disconnect T1, T2, T3 and G at VFG 3.
- Perform continuity check (closed circuit= failure) at the terminal block of VFG 3 as follows:
From To Result VFG 3-T1 Ground VFG 3-T2 Ground VFG 3-T3 Ground - If there is continuity, go to step 25.
- If there is no continuity, continue with next step.
- Perform wiring checks (open circuit= failure) between VFG 3 and ACPC VFG 3 as follow:
From To Result VFG 3-T1 ACPC VFG 3-T7 VFG 3-T2 ACPC VFG 3-T8 VFG 3-T3 ACPC VFG 3-T9 - If wiring checks are not good,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- Disconnect connector G3P1 on the VFG 3.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) on VFG 3 as follows:
From To Result G3P1-F G3P1-D G3P1-E G3P1-D G3P1-J G3P1-D - If there is no continuity, go to step 25.
- If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- Perform continuity check (closed circuit= failure) on VFG 3 as follows:
From To Result G3P1-F Ground G3P1-E Ground G3P1-J Ground G3P1-D Ground - If there is continuity, go to step 25.
- If there is no continuity, continue with next step.
- Disconnect GCU 3 connector A58P2.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) between G3P1 and A58P2 as follows:
From To Result G3P1-F A58P2-41 G3P1-E A58P2-42 G3P1-J A58P2-50 G3P1-D A58P2-40 - If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- If there is no continuity,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- Perform wiring checks (closed circuit= failure) as follow:
From To Result G3P1-F Ground G3P1-E Ground G3P1-J Ground - If wiring checks are not good,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- Disconnect ACPC connector A54P3.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) between A58P2 and A54P3 as follows:
From To Result A58P2-49 A54P3-E A58P2-57 A54P3-F A58P2-63 A54P3-G A58P2-62 A54P3-H - If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- If there is no continuity,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- Perform wiring checks (closed circuit= failure) as follow:
From To Result A58P2-49 Ground A58P2-57 Ground A58P2-63 Ground - If wiring checks are not good,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) between VFG3 and K10 as follows:
From To Result VFG 3-T1 K10-A3 VFG 3-T2 K10-B3 VFG 3-T3 K10-C3 - If there is continuity, go to step 17.
- If there is no continuity, continue with next step.
- Repair wiring (including inside ACPC) between VFG3 and K10 as follows:
From To Result VFG 3-T1 K10-A3 VFG 3-T2 K10-B3 VFG 3-T3 K10-C3 - If system checks are good, do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
NOTE: Call Bombardier for decision to repair ACPC wiring or replace ACPC.
- Perform wiring checks (closed circuit= failure) as follow:
From To Result VFG 3-T1 Ground VFG 3-T2 Ground VFG 3-T3 Ground - If wiring checks are not good, repair defective wiring as required and do close out.
- If wiring checks are good, continue with next step.
- On current transducer 3 (LCTA3), disconnect connector PL3.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) in ACPC between A54P3 and PL3 as follows:
From To Result A54P3-E PL3-1 A54P3-F PL3-2 A54P3-G PL3-3 A54P3-H PL3-4 - If there is no continuity, go to step 26.
- If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) in ACPC between A54P3 and ground as follows:
From To Result A54P3-E Ground A54P3-F Ground A54P3-G Ground - If there is continuity, go to step 26.
- If there is no continuity, continue with next step.
- Perform continuity check (open circuit= failure) at connector PL3 as follows:
From To Result PL3-1 PL3-4 PL3-2 PL3-4 PL3-3 PL3-4 - If there is no continuity, go to step 23.
- If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- Perform continuity check (short circuit= failure) at connector between JL3 and ground as follows:
From To Result JL3-1 Ground JL3-2 Ground JL3-3 Ground - If there is no continuity, go to step 24.
- If there is continuity, continue with next step.
- Replace LCTA3.
- If system checks are good, do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Replace GLC3 (K10).
- If system checks are good, do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Swap VFG 3 with VFG 4.
- If system checks are good, replace VFG 3 and do close out.
- If fault remains, continue with next step.
- Replace ACPC.
- Do close out.
